## Process Definition
Business processes can be defined as a series of interrelated activities that transform inputs into outputs to achieve specific goals. They typically include tasks such as customer service, product development, financial management, human resources, and more.
## Key Stages in Business Processes
1. **Planning**
- **Objective Setting**: Establish clear goals and objectives.
- **Resource Allocation**: Identify necessary resources and allocate them effectively.
- **Risk Management**: Assess potential risks and develop mitigation strategies.
2. **Execution**
- **Task Assignment**: Assign tasks to appropriate individuals or teams.
- **Process Automation**: Implement automation tools where feasible to streamline workflows.
- **Monitoring and Control**: Regularly monitor progress and adjust processes as needed.
3. **Review and Improvement**
- **Performance Evaluation**: Conduct regular performance evaluations to identify areas for improvement.
- **Feedback Mechanism**: Encourage feedback from all stakeholders to make data-driven decisions.
- **Continuous Learning**: Invest in training and development programs to keep employees up-to-date with industry trends.
## Best Practices for Managing Business Processes
- **Standardization**: Develop standardized procedures and templates to ensure consistency across departments.
- **Collaboration Tools**: Utilize collaboration platforms like Slack, Microsoft Teams, or Asana to enhance communication and teamwork.
- **Data Analytics**: Leverage data analytics to gain insights into process performance and make informed decisions.
- **Employee Engagement**: Foster a culture of employee engagement through regular feedback sessions and recognition programs.
- **Regular Audits**: Conduct periodic audits to evaluate the effectiveness of processes and identify any gaps.
